ABOUT THE BC PSYCHOSIS PROGRAM:
BC Psychosis Program is located on the University of British Columbia campus in Detwiller Pavilion. Our Program provides highly specialized assessment and treatment for adults whose psychotic illness has been difficult to treat and/or for whom the psychiatric diagnosis is unclear.
Quick Facts:
bed numbers: 25
length of stay: 3-5 months

Vancouver Coastal Health (VCH) is a world class innovator in medical care, research and teaching, delivering service to more than one million BC residents living in Vancouver, Vancouver's North Shore, Richmond, the Sea-to-Sky Highway, Sunshine Coast, and the Central Coast (Bella Bella and Bella Coola.)
